Band members get engaged on-stage at Cork Pride’s Party at the Port

You love to see it!
Sunday’s Party at the Port for Cork Pride went down a storm yesterday, with loads of revellers turning up for the drive-in gig in their cars, and in the case of host RuPaul Ryder, a quad bike.

Covid has presented many challenges to event organisers, but Cork Pride certainly brought the love yesterday, with tunes provided by Stephanie Rainey, Sparkle, and DJ Marty Guilfoyle.
The undoubted highlight of the event, however, came as Sparkle were closing out their set. As they wrapped up their last song, Sparkle singer Caroline surprised everyone in the audience and on-stage by getting down on one knee and proposing to her bandmate and now-fiancée Jen.
Wonderfully, National Ambulance Service member Ger O’Dea was on hand to capture the magical moment, so you can see for yourself what happened next.
